The thing to remember is that shipping times are essentially random, and on top of that random factor you have the time required to go through GW's internal shipping and handling queues. If there's a situation where there are a lot of orders (more than can get shipped out in one day), the orders that get processed first are going to go out "early" and probably arrive "early" with no deliberate benevolence involved.

In the past, I think people have reported getting things like the spearhead boxes up to week early, so a codex a few days early isn't too surprising.
